Transaction 0152b9103938f68075640871b30e30677eddbf3ca4ba66a3fb5351eb4e002565

2 Input
2 Outputs
  • 0152b9103938f68075640871b30e30677eddbf3ca4ba66a3fb5351eb4e002565:0
  • value  469968
    address  3E1zT9tD7RwGsxjtJMsSFv54RenKFj6JYA
  • 0152b9103938f68075640871b30e30677eddbf3ca4ba66a3fb5351eb4e002565:1
  • value  12854556
    address  bc1qsruamg495pk9qfsrgykc77aqdztcl8pj259ffs